SUMMER CARNIVAL '92 - RECCA & ALZADICK SCORING AND CONTEST RULES:
So, I have figured out the points system for Recca/Alzadick and here's how it will break down:
Scores will be taken for Score Attack (2 minute mode) and Time Attack (5 minute mode) for each game and the first five places will get points. The one with the most points at the end wins There will be a grand prize for the overall winner.
The game modes work like this: In Score Attack, the object is to score as many points in 2 mintues as possible. In Time Attack, you want to score 1 million points as fast as possible with the limit being five minutes.
Points scoring breaks down by place like this:
1st place - 7 points
2nd place - 5 points
3rd place - 3 points
4th place - 2 points
5th place - 1 point
The only other rule I'm thinking about implementing is that you need to post scores for each of the titles and each of the modes, so each player will have four scores tallied to be eligible for an overall score.
I will be taking scores during the event and everytime you want to post a score on the score board, you'll have to make sure I see the score so I can enter it on the sheet, which you will initial to ok. Pretty easy stuff. I'll abstain from the contest proper as well.
